WebNov 7, 2024 · 3. Definition of Leadership Styles. Before we dive into the subject of different leadership styles, let’s take a look at what defines a leadership style. Simply said, it’s the method a leader uses to influence, motivate and direct a group of employees to achieve organizational goals. WebDemocratic Leadership. Democratic leadership, also known as participative leadership, serves as a combination of the autocratic leadership style and laissez-faire leadership style. These leaders ask for input from others before making decisions. Pros: Allows employees to feel heard and as if their contributions matter; Often leads to a higher ...

WebFeb 1, 2024 · 5. Autocratic Leadership. Autocratic leadership exists on the opposite side of the spectrum from democratic leadership. You can think of this as a “my way or the highway” approach. Autocratic leaders view themselves as having absolute power and make decisions on behalf of their subordinates.
